Preparing Your iPhone 12 Pro for Sale

Before listing your iPhone, ensure it is in the best possible condition. Clean the device thoroughly, remove any personal data, and reset it to factory settings. Check that all features, including the camera, screen, and buttons, are working properly. Gather accessories like the original charger, cable, and box if available, as these can increase the device’s appeal.

Determining the Right Price

Pricing competitively is key to attracting local buyers. Research the current market value of an iPhone 12 Pro 128GB in your area by checking online marketplaces and local listings. Consider the device’s condition, whether it includes accessories, and any warranties or guarantees you can offer. Setting a fair and transparent price will encourage quicker sales.

Creating an Effective Listing

When advertising your iPhone, include clear, high-quality photos from multiple angles. Write a detailed description highlighting key features, condition, and any extras included. Be honest about any flaws or wear to build trust with potential buyers. Mention that the sale is local and specify your location to attract nearby buyers.

Choosing the Best Selling Platforms

Utilize local online marketplaces such as Facebook Marketplace, Craigslist, OfferUp, or local buy-and-sell groups. These platforms connect you directly with nearby buyers, making the transaction easier and faster. Additionally, consider posting flyers in community centers or local shops to reach potential buyers who prefer offline methods.

Communicating with Buyers

Respond promptly and politely to inquiries. Be prepared to answer questions about the device’s condition, history, and reason for selling. Arrange a safe, public meeting place for the transaction, and consider accepting cash or secure digital payments. Always verify the buyer’s identity if possible.

Finalizing the Sale

Once you’ve agreed on a price, meet in a public location to exchange the device and payment. Test the iPhone together to ensure it works as described. Provide a receipt or simple bill of sale for record-keeping. After the sale, reset the device again to remove your data and prepare it for the new owner.
